How much do machine shop project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for machine shop project manager in Owasso, OK is $64,805.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$49,200.00 and $76,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a machine shop project manager do?

A Machine Shop Project Manager oversees the planning, execution, and completion of manufacturing projects within a machine shop. They coordinate between clients, engineers, machinists, and other stakeholders to ensure projects are delivered on time, within budget, and to required quality standards. Their responsibilities include scheduling, resource allocation, risk management, and ensuring compliance with safety and industry regulations. Effective communication and problem-solving skills are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a machine shop project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Machine Shop Project Manager, you need a solid background in manufacturing processes, project management, and engineering principles, often supported by a degree in mechanical engineering or industrial management. Familiarity with CAD/CAM software, ERP systems, and certifications such as PMP or Six Sigma are typically valuable for this role.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ication help you coordinate teams and manage client expectations. These skills are crucial for ensuring projects are completed on time, within budget, and to the required quality standards in a fast-paced production environment.

What are some common challenges faced by a machine shop project manager, and how can they be addressed?

Machine Shop Project Managers often encounter challenges such as coordinating complex production schedules, ensuring on-time delivery of custom parts, and managing resource constraints. Balancing multiple projects while maintaining strict quality and safety standards can be demanding. Effective communication with machinists, engineers, and clients is crucial to anticipate issues early and resolve them efficiently. Utilizing project management software and fostering a collaborative team environment helps streamline workflows and mitigate potential delays.

What is the difference between Machine Shop Project Manager vs Machinist?

AspectMachine Shop Project ManagerMachinist
Required CredentialsExperience in project management, industry certifications (e.g., PMP), technical knowledgeTechnical training, certifications in machining or CNC operation
Work EnvironmentOffice setting with supervision of shop activitiesShop floor operating machines and tools
Employer & Industry UsageManufacturing companies, machine shops overseeing projectsMachine shops, manufacturing facilities performing machining tasks

The main difference is that a Machine Shop Project Manager oversees multiple projects, manages teams, and coordinates schedules, while a Machinist operates machines to produce parts. The project manager focuses on planning and supervision, whereas the machinist handles the technical execution on the shop floor.

Job Summary:
The Project Manager will provide overall project management support, to plan, budget, monitor, execute and oversee all aspects of the project to ensure that scope, cost and project direction are maintained through the project lifecycle.
Job Responsibilities:
Planning and defining project scope.
Activity planning, sequencing and developing schedules.
Risk Analysis and managing risks and issues.
Monitoring and reporting progress of scope and budgets, help develop clean shop release file and confirm scope of supply based on customer specifications and sales quotation verify equipment selection and design and perform/coordinate required calculations and sketches to establish equipment design coordinates drafting for job.
Make sure all required drawings are completed. Reviews customer mark-up prints and aid drafting as to disposition for final approvals and shop release.
Establishes and tracks the cost budget for jobs by working with Sales Department and cost specialists.
Maintains delivery schedule for job based on Customer requirements and Zeeco workloads, including coordination of drafting, purchasing, manufacturing and quality control. Co-ordination of pre-ordered materials as required for meeting delivery within schedules.
Aid/Inform/Involved with Quality Control Department with customer/job specifications; ITP requirements and any exceptional customer or QC detail.
Coordinates all required technical and commercial correspondence related to the job. This includes all internal communications and furthermore coordinates all correspondence with Customer, end user, sales reps, and/or outside consultants whether through business support or personally.
Maintaining change management notifying sales and estimating departments when changes occur to the scope of supply and/or design of the equipment that affect the price. Coordinates written advice and price resolution with Customer concerning price revisions.
Coordinate and update project documentation.
Create project invoices via excel for finance.
Perform other related duties as assigned. Some of these duties may include:-Quotation/sales support, Field/sales trips, Design Engineering
Assist in designing and producing engineering drawings (valve assemblies, electrical connection diagrams, P&ID's, detailing equipment for manufacture).
Work from sketches, models, and verbal information supplied by sales/engineering/drafting to determine the most appropriate views, detailed drawings, and supplementary information needed to complete assignments.
Select required information from precedents and guides.
Ensure final packs meet customer requirements: MDR, OM as required
Utilize computer-assisted drafting (CAD) system to complete assignments.
Ensuring scope of supply is met fully but not exceeded.
Education:
Relevant Engineering degree
Knowledge/ Experience
Essential
Project engineering experience -4 years minimum
Including but not limited to plant selection, budget developments and control through life cycle, QC, change management, internal and external customer communications, from conceptual design through to delivery and installation.
Understanding of fabrication (welding, ASME standards, PED, etc)
